Reminders -

Activity Supervision & Verification of Hours -

  • Whenever possible, all CAS activities should be supervised by an adult. Ideally, this adult should not be related to you.
  • Before beginning a CAS Activity, give your potential supervisor a copy of the Supervisor Intro Letter  
  • At the completion of every CAS Activity, you must have your supervisor complete the Activity Supervisor Evaluation Form. 
  • If your activity is either (a) supervised by a parent or (b) not supervised by an adult - you must provide evidence/verification of participation and completion. Potential forms of alternative evidence include: picture/video, blogs, webpages, certificates of completion, awards, meeting notes and emails.

15th of the Month Deadline -

  • The Activity Completion Form, which includes the End of Activity Reflection, are due the 15th of each month for any activities completed in the previous month. 
  • For example, reflections for activities that ended in September are due October 15. Failure to submit the documentation on time will result in the student not receiving credit for the activity.
